ECC approves increase in monthly gas meter rent from Rs 20 to Rs 40

ISLAMABAD, SEP 30 (DNA) – The Economic Coordination Committee (ECC) has approved collection of Rs 22 billion from consumers in the name of gas development surcharge.  The monthly rent of gas meters has also been increased from Rs 20 to Rs 40. The ECC meeting was held in Islamabad under the chairmanship of Finance Advisor Hafeez Sheikh on Wednesday. ATC extends interim bail of Safdar, Sanaullah in NAB office clash

LAHORE, SEP 30 (DNA) – An anti-terrorism court (ATC) in Lahore has extended interim bail of Pakistan Muslim League Nawaz (PML-N) leaders Rana Sanaullah and Capt (retd) Safdar in a case related to clash outside the National Accountability Bureau (NAB) office during the appearance of Maryam Nawaz. The ATC extended interim bail of Capt (retd) Safdar and Rana Sanaullah till October 6. NCOC recommends smart lockdown in Karachi to curb COVID-19

ISLAMABAD, SEP 30 (DNA) – The National Command and Operation Center (NCOC) on Wednesday expressed its concern over spike in COVID-19 cases in Karachi and recommended smart lockdown in the port city to curb hike in coronavirus infections. The NCOC meeting was briefed that out of total 747 positive cases reported in the country in 24 hours, 365 infections were reported in Karachi. Pakistan envoy presents credentials to President of Austria

VIENNA, SEP 30 (DNA) – Ambassador Aftab Ahmed Khokher, presented his credentials to the Federal President of the Republic of Austria, Dr Alexander Van der Bellen, during an official ceremony held at the Hofburg Palace in Vienna Wednesday. Presenting his credentials, Ambassador Khokher conveyed to the Federal President the warm greetings of President Dr. Arif Alvi and Prime Minister Imran Khan. He pledged to further strengthen and expand the bilateral relations between Pakistan and Austria, a press release issued by the Ministry of Foreign Affairs here said.
